The SMAJ7.0A-E3/61 belongs to the category of TVS (Transient Voltage Suppressor) diodes.
It is used for protecting sensitive electronic components from voltage transients induced by lightning, ESD (electrostatic discharge), and other transient voltage events.
The SMAJ7.0A-E3/61 is typically available in a DO-214AC (SMA) package.
The essence of this product lies in its ability to divert excessive current away from sensitive components, thereby safeguarding them from damage due to voltage spikes.
The SMAJ7.0A-E3/61 is commonly packaged in reels with quantities varying based on manufacturer specifications.
The SMAJ7.0A-E3/61 typically has two pins, anode, and cathode, which are denoted by the '+' and '-' symbols respectively.
When a transient voltage event occurs, the SMAJ7.0A-E3/61 conducts excess current to ground, limiting the voltage across the protected circuit.
The SMAJ7.0A-E3/61 is widely used in various applications including: - Telecommunication equipment - Industrial control systems - Automotive electronics - Power supplies - Consumer electronics
